Understanding how much a kilobyte is and how the measurement scales across different tiers of data is fundamental to navigating the modern digital landscape. A kilobyte, often abbreviated as KB, is a unit of digital information that represents 1,024 bytes, although in some contexts, particularly storage marketing, it is sometimes loosely interpreted as 1,000 bytes. This unit serves as the foundational building block for measuring file sizes, memory allocation, and data transfer, making it essential for both technical professionals and everyday users to grasp its true meaning.
The Definition and Structure of a Kilobyte
At its core, a kilobyte is a binary unit of measurement rooted in the base-2 numbering system used by computers. Unlike the decimal system, which counts in multiples of 10, computers operate using bits and bytes where calculations are based on powers of two. Specifically, one kilobyte is defined as 1,024 bytes, which is derived from 2 to the power of 10 (2^10). This specific value was chosen because it aligns with the binary architecture of computing systems, providing a efficient way to address memory locations and process data in chunks that align with hardware limitations.
Kilobytes vs. Decimal Kilobytes
It is important to distinguish between the binary definition and the decimal interpretation often used in marketing. In the binary system, which is the standard for computing and memory, a kilobyte is 1,024 bytes. However, the International System of Units (SI) defines a kilo as 1,000, leading to some confusion in product labeling. Hard drive and solid-state drive manufacturers frequently use the decimal system, claiming 1 gigabyte as 1,000,000,000 bytes, whereas operating systems like Windows and macOS report storage using the binary system, showing it as approximately 0.93 gigabytes. This discrepancy can lead to the perception of "missing" space, when in reality it is simply a difference in measurement methodology.
The Practical Size of a Kilobyte
To put the scale of a kilobyte into perspective, consider that a single typewritten page in a standard font might contain roughly 2,000 to 5,000 characters, which translates to about 2 to 5 kilobytes. A high-quality JPEG image from a modern smartphone typically ranges from 200 KB to 3,000 KB depending on resolution and compression. Text files are generally very lean, with a document containing only words often weighing in under 10 KB, whereas a complex spreadsheet or a simple vector graphic might push into the hundreds of kilobytes. This unit is small enough to be efficient for simple data but large enough to handle meaningful amounts of information.
Scaling Up: From Kilobytes to Gigabytes
While the kilobyte is useful for small files, data scales exponentially to meet the demands of modern applications and media. The progression moves from kilobytes to megabytes, then gigabytes, and beyond, each step being 1,024 times larger than the previous one. Specifically, 1,024 kilobytes combine to form one megabyte (MB), which is suitable for audio files and smaller images. Megabytes then combine to form gigabytes (GB), the standard unit for today’s smartphones and laptops, where 1,024 megabytes equal one gigabyte. Understanding this progression helps users contextualize their storage needs and data usage patterns, whether they are managing a single document or an entire digital library.